Overview of Phase Control Thyristor
A phase control thyristor, often referred to as a triac or SCR (Silicon Controlled Rectifier) in certain applications, is a semiconductor device used for controlling the amount of power delivered to a load by adjusting the phase angle at which the AC waveform is allowed to conduct. This method of control is known as phase angle control or simply phase control. Phase control thyristors are widely used in various applications that require precise regulation of electrical power, such as lighting dimmers, motor speed controls, temperature controllers, and more.
Features of Phase Control Thyristor
Phase Angle Control: Allows adjustment of the conduction point within each half-cycle of the AC waveform, enabling precise control over the average power delivered to the load.
High Efficiency: Operates with minimal losses when conducting, providing efficient power control.
Bidirectional Conductivity (Triacs): For AC applications, triacs can conduct current in both directions, making them suitable for full-wave control of AC loads.
Unidirectional Conductivity (SCRs): SCRs conduct current in one direction only and are typically used for half-wave control of AC or DC loads.
Gate Triggering: Conduction begins when a small current is applied to the gate terminal, allowing for easy control of the turn-on point.
Latching Current: Once triggered, the thyristor continues to conduct until the current through it falls below a certain level called the holding current.
Temperature Sensitivity: Performance can be affected by temperature changes, requiring thermal management considerations in design.
Voltage and Current Ratings: Available in a wide range of voltage and current ratings to suit different application needs.
Noise Generation: Can generate electromagnetic interference (EMI), necessitating proper filtering and shielding in sensitive applications.
Protection Mechanisms: Often include built-in protection against overvoltage and overcurrent conditions to safeguard the device and connected systems.

The Westcode N390CH32 is a powerful SCR thyristor module. It handles high currents and voltages reliably. This component excels at SCR phase control. SCR phase control manages AC power delivery precisely. It works by delaying the turn-on point within the AC waveform. This action effectively controls the average power sent to a load. The N390CH32 finds many uses because of this capability.
Industrial heating systems use it extensively. Precise temperature control is critical for furnaces, ovens, and induction heaters. The N390CH32 adjusts power to heating elements smoothly. This ensures stable temperatures and process consistency. It saves energy too.
Motor speed control is another key application. Large AC motors in factories need variable speed. The N390CH32 regulates power to the motor windings. This changes the motor’s rotational speed accurately. It provides smooth starting and stopping also. This protects machinery.
Lighting systems benefit from its power management. High-intensity discharge lamps need controlled power-up. The N390CH32 handles the initial surge well. It allows for dimming large lighting installations too. This extends bulb life and saves electricity.
Power supplies and converters rely on this thyristor. It performs well in AC voltage regulators. It functions effectively in soft starters for motors. It acts reliably in static switches for transferring power sources. Its robust construction handles demanding electrical environments. It offers long service life with minimal maintenance needs.
